Wellamoon Sleep Patch: Does It Work?

does wellamoon sleep patch work

Wellamoon's sleep patches are designed to help people sleep better. The patches contain melatonin and valerian root, which are absorbed through the skin to help people fall asleep and stay asleep. While some customers have found the patches effective, others have reported that they did not work for them. The product currently has a 4-star rating on Trustpilot, with 2,020 reviews.

Mixed reviews on effectiveness

The Wellamoon Sleep Patch has received mixed reviews from customers regarding its effectiveness. While some customers have found the patches effective in improving their sleep quality and duration, others have reported that the patches did not work for them at all or stopped working after some time.

Some positive reviews highlight that the patches have helped individuals with insomnia get almost 7 hours of sleep, even if it is not continuous. One reviewer mentioned that the patches helped them sleep like they haven't in years, and another stated that the patches allowed them to wake up feeling refreshed and less groggy. Wellamoon claims that their patches have an absorption rate of 65% compared to 15% for most oral supplements, delivering ingredients directly into the bloodstream for optimal sleep.

On the other hand, negative reviews suggest that the patches were inconvenient and uncomfortable to sleep with due to their hardness. Some customers also experienced issues with their orders, such as unexpected additional charges and difficulties in obtaining refunds. One reviewer mentioned that the patches did not help them sleep at all, contrary to the product's advertisement.

It is worth noting that individual factors, such as melatonin levels and sleep patterns, can influence the effectiveness of sleep patches. While research into sleep patches is still emerging, oral melatonin supplements have been more extensively studied and are known to be effective in aiding sleep.

High absorption rate

Wellamoon Sleep Patches are designed to help people fall asleep faster and improve their sleep quality. The patches contain a blend of natural ingredients, including valerian root, magnesium malate, hops, and melatonin, which work together to calm the mind and relax the body.

The key to the effectiveness of Wellamoon Sleep Patches lies in their high absorption rate. Unlike oral supplements, which have a short half-life and are quickly broken down by the body, Wellamoon Sleep Patches utilise transdermal delivery. This means that the active ingredients are absorbed directly through the skin and into the bloodstream. As a result, the patches provide a slow and steady release of melatonin and other ingredients throughout the night.

Transdermal patches have a significantly higher absorption rate compared to oral supplements. Wellamoon claims that their patches have an absorption rate of 65%, compared to just 15% for most oral supplements. This higher absorption rate ensures that a greater proportion of the active ingredients reach the bloodstream, potentially enhancing their effectiveness in promoting sleep.

The transdermal delivery method also bypasses the digestive system, which can break down and reduce the potency of oral supplements. By avoiding first-pass metabolism, more of the active ingredients remain intact and available for the body to utilise. This may contribute to the perceived effectiveness of the patches in improving sleep quality.

While the high absorption rate of Wellamoon Sleep Patches is a key advantage, individual results may vary. Customer reviews for the patches are mixed, with some people finding them effective in improving their sleep while others report no noticeable benefits. It is important to remember that the effectiveness of any sleep aid can depend on various factors, including individual physiology, sleep habits, and underlying health conditions.

Natural ingredients

Wellamoon Sleep Patches contain four main natural ingredients: Valerian Root, Magnesium Malate, Hops, and Melatonin. The patches also use a medical-grade hypoallergenic adhesive to ensure gentle application to the skin.

Valerian Root is a herbal extract that has been used for centuries to promote sleep and relaxation. It is known for its calming and sedative properties, helping to reduce anxiety and improve sleep quality. Magnesium Malate is a form of magnesium that plays a crucial role in regulating sleep and wake cycles. It helps to relax the body and prepare it for sleep. Hops, the flower cones of the hop plant, are commonly used in beer brewing and have a calming effect on the body, aiding in sleep induction and improvement.

Melatonin is a hormone produced naturally in the body. It is often referred to as the "sleep hormone" because it regulates sleep-wake cycles and helps maintain the body's internal clock. Melatonin supplements are a popular over-the-counter sleep aid, and when delivered through a transdermal patch, it can help people stay asleep. The slow-release system of the Wellamoon patch allows for the gradual release of these natural ingredients into the body throughout the night, promoting a restful night's sleep.

May not work for everyone

The Wellamoon Sleep Patch is a melatonin-based sleep aid that is applied topically. Melatonin is a naturally occurring hormone in the body that makes you feel sleepy. Melatonin supplements are popular over-the-counter sleep aids and are available in various forms, including pills, tablets, gummies, liquids, lozenges, sublingual melts, sprays, and transdermal patches.

While the Wellamoon Sleep Patch has received positive reviews from some customers, there are also several negative reviews indicating that the product may not work for everyone. Some customers have reported that the patches were ineffective in improving their sleep, with some stating that they did not sleep at all after using the patches. Others have mentioned that the patches stopped working after some time or that they found the patches inconvenient to use due to their hardness.

It is important to note that the effectiveness of sleep aids can vary depending on individual factors such as the underlying causes of sleep disturbances, lifestyle habits, and physiological differences in melatonin absorption. Additionally, the safety and efficacy of supplements are not closely monitored by regulatory bodies like the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A), so it is essential for shoppers to be cautious and purchase reputable products.

While melatonin patches have been found effective in helping people maintain sleep in some studies, more research is needed to fully understand their efficacy compared to other forms of melatonin supplements. Individual variations in response to the patches may also exist, and it is always advisable to consult a healthcare professional before starting any new supplement or treatment for sleep disturbances.

Safety and side effects

The Wellamoon Sleep Patch is formulated with a blend of natural ingredients, including Valerian Root, Magnesium Malate, Hops, and Melatonin. The patch is designed to be easy to use, with users simply peeling off a protective sticker and applying the patch to a clean, hairless area of the body. The ingredients are then absorbed through the skin, with Wellamoon claiming an absorption rate of 65% for their patches, compared to 15% for most oral supplements.

While Wellamoon Sleep Patches are likely safe for short-term use, as is the case with oral melatonin supplements, there are some potential side effects that users should be aware of. These include headaches, dizziness, irritability, temporary depressive feelings, and stomach cramps. It is important to note that melatonin induces sleepiness, so users should refrain from driving or operating heavy machinery while under the influence of the supplement. Melatonin may also pose additional risks for people who are pregnant, breastfeeding, or trying to become pregnant.

Customer reviews for the Wellamoon Sleep Patch are mixed, with some finding the patches effective in improving their sleep, while others report that they did not find the patches helpful. Some users have also reported issues with the company's customer service and billing practices, with unexpected charges and difficulty obtaining refunds for unwanted products.

It is worth noting that melatonin supplements, including patches, are not closely monitored by regulatory bodies like the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A). Therefore, shoppers should exercise caution and purchase products from reputable sources to ensure their safety.
